a weekly woodwork class for home-educated children
the classes offer a mixture of group teaching (learning tools and techniques) and individual making (working on their own projects). we teach a range of hand tools and power tools depending on age and ability. scrap materials are provided but children are welcome to bring their own materials for small-scale projects
the classes are fortnightly on Tuesdays from 1:30pm until 3:30pm and cost £20 per child, per session. we currently have ongoing classes for 8 - 11 year olds*
there are 8 spaces in each class

this two-day - school holiday - class will introduce a range of carpentry power tools. we'll be working on making a small table - but this isn't the end goal of the class - it gives us a purpose whilst learning how the tools work and how to use them safely
by the end of the class you should have a sense of what the possibilities are with each tool and how you might use your new carpentry skills to complete your own projects
no experience is necessary. you'll learn to use the track saw, chop saw, sander, and a drill.

in this carpentry class you'll learn a range of traditional hand tools and techniques in the process of making a small stool. we'll show you how to to cut, fit, and finish the wood in different ways and the skills you gain will be really useful at home for your own projects
using different Western and Japanese hand-saws, we'll cut a single board into five parts, then plane and chisel each to size before assembling them using glue and screws. this process will teach you different sawing and finishing techniques, and the basics of using a drill
the class offers a lot of useful guidance about how to use the tools and materials in a variety of ways. you'll finish the day with a wonderful stool to take away with you
